Aracılığıyla paylaş


BrowserFileExtensions.RequestImageFileAsync Yöntem

Tanım

Geçerli görüntü dosyasını belirtilen dosya türünden ve en büyük dosya boyutlarından birine dönüştürmeye çalışır.

Dikkat: Dönüştürme öncesinde veya sonrasında dosyanın dönüştürüleceğinin veya hatta geçerli bir görüntü dosyası olacağının garantisi yoktur. Dönüştürme, .NET koduna aktarılmadan önce tarayıcı içinde istenir, bu nedenle sonuçta elde edilen veriler güvenilmeyen olarak kabul edilmelidir.

public:
[System::Runtime::CompilerServices::Extension]
 static System::Threading::Tasks::ValueTask<Microsoft::AspNetCore::Components::Forms::IBrowserFile ^> RequestImageFileAsync(Microsoft::AspNetCore::Components::Forms::IBrowserFile ^ browserFile, System::String ^ format, int maxWith, int maxHeight);
public static System.Threading.Tasks.ValueTask<Microsoft.AspNetCore.Components.Forms.IBrowserFile> RequestImageFileAsync (this Microsoft.AspNetCore.Components.Forms.IBrowserFile browserFile, string format, int maxWith, int maxHeight);
public static System.Threading.Tasks.ValueTask<Microsoft.AspNetCore.Components.Forms.IBrowserFile> RequestImageFileAsync (this Microsoft.AspNetCore.Components.Forms.IBrowserFile browserFile, string format, int maxWidth, int maxHeight);
static member RequestImageFileAsync : Microsoft.AspNetCore.Components.Forms.IBrowserFile * string * int * int -> System.Threading.Tasks.ValueTask<Microsoft.AspNetCore.Components.Forms.IBrowserFile>
static member RequestImageFileAsync : Microsoft.AspNetCore.Components.Forms.IBrowserFile * string * int * int -> System.Threading.Tasks.ValueTask<Microsoft.AspNetCore.Components.Forms.IBrowserFile>
<Extension()>
Public Function RequestImageFileAsync (browserFile As IBrowserFile, format As String, maxWith As Integer, maxHeight As Integer) As ValueTask(Of IBrowserFile)
<Extension()>
Public Function RequestImageFileAsync (browserFile As IBrowserFile, format As String, maxWidth As Integer, maxHeight As Integer) As ValueTask(Of IBrowserFile)

Parametreler

browserFile
IBrowserFile

IBrowserFile yeni bir görüntü dosyasına dönüştürülecek.

format
String

Yeni görüntü biçimi.

maxWithmaxWidth
Int32

En yüksek görüntü genişliği.

maxHeight
Int32

En yüksek görüntü yüksekliği

Döndürülenler

ValueTask İşlemin tamamlanmasını temsil eden bir.

Açıklamalar

Görüntü, özgün en boy oranı korunarak belirtilen boyutlara uyacak şekilde ölçeklendirilir.

Şunlara uygulanır